Dragon offensive analysis
Dragon hits Dragon super-effective. That's it — but Dragon STAB is uniquely 'spammable' because few defensive types resist it well (Steel and Fairy). Outrage (120 BP physical, 2-3 turn lock-in then confused) and Draco Meteor (130 BP special, lowers SpA after) are the high-BP options. Specs Hydreigon Draco Meteor 2HKOs anything that doesn't resist Dragon.

Best Dragon dual-type combos
Dragon / Ground
Examples: Garchomp, Zygarde, Flygon
Earthquake + Dragon STAB; only weak to Ice, Fairy, Dragon
Dragon / Steel
Examples: Dialga, Duraludon, Archaludon
Drops Fairy weakness; Dragon Tail forces switches
Dragon / Dark
Examples: Hydreigon, Roaring Moon
Drops Fairy weakness; Dark Pulse coverage on Steels
Dragon / Ghost
Examples: Dragapult, Giratina-O
Norm/Fighting immune; Specs Draco + Shadow Ball coverage
Dragon type history & meta shifts
Dragon was banned/restricted in Smogon for years (Dragonite in Gen 4-5 was on the edge of OU bannable). Gen 6 Fairy was specifically designed to nerf Dragon, and it worked — Dragon-types like Latios dropped from OU to UU briefly. Tera Steel on Dragons (Gen 9) flips the Fairy weakness into resistance, restoring offensive viability.
